1865 Continued very bad roads and rain distance 9 miles 30th Started at 10 oclock, A.M. Marched untill 6, P.M. companies E, K and, G guarding prisoners roads very bad distance 8 miles 31st Started at 5 1/2 oclock. A.M. marched untill 2 P.M. camped on the Tensaw Buyo distance 17 miles April. 4. month, 1865 1st Started at 10 oclock A.M. marched untill 8 P.M camped was on regimental guard distance 8 miles 2nd Sunday Started at 5 1/2 oclock A.M. Marched about 6 miles and came up with the enemy 2 miles from Bleakeley Ala Skirmishing in front companies H, E and K guarding prisoners but was relieved by the 2nd N.Y. cavelry at 12 M reported to the regt. regt. moved to the left wing and at dark went to support the picketts
